Web Imaging
has the necessary image processing functionality for preparing images for the Web:

-opens images in the following formats: JPEG, PNG, GIF, BMP, TIFF, PCX, TARGA;
-imports images from TWAIN compatible input devices;
-imports images from the HTML files (lists and opens the images mentioned in the HTML file body);
-saves images in the following formats: JPEG, PNG, GIF, BMP, TIFF, TARGA;
-exports images in JPEG, PNG, GIF formats ( JPEG Example, PNG Example);
-converts colors with tuning of the dithering level;
-edits palette and transparency colors;
-smart cuts of the images (cuts the part of the image with the set aspect ratio) for thumbnail generation;
-creates browser side image maps in HTML 2.0 format;
-copies, pastes and crops images;
-controls brightness, contrast and light intensity of the images;
-resizes (resamples), rotates and flips images.

Web Imaging is constructed as the plug-in concept. Because of this concept, new file formats and operations can easily be added by 1SA or third parties. Web Imaging also can be used as a plug in for other popular image processing packages like Adobe PhotoShop.

System Requirements:
Required: 486 or faster processor, Windows 95 or Windows NT 4.0, 12 MB RAM, 10 MB available hard disk space, 256-color display adapter.

Recommended:
Pentium ® processor, Windows 95, Windows 98, Windows NT or higher, 32 MB RAM or more, 20 MB available hard disk space or more, 24-bit display adapter at 1024x768 resolution. Some system requirements may vary depending on the size of the images processed. Available memory should be at least four times the uncompressed image size. Multi level undo is limited by the available hard disk space.
